Patient's Query

Hi doctor,

I am a boy. My height is five feet and eight inches, but my weight is only 59 kilograms. I am very lean. I have also started gym. It has been months. I have not seen any major change in my health. I am not taking any protein supplements. But I need more than my present diet to support my workout. I am feeling weak. I am planning to take protein. Would like to take your suggestion.

Thank you.

Answered by Dr. Atul Prakash

Hi,

Welcome to icliniq.com.

I suggest you consider increasing the protein intake to 100 grams daily and see if that works. In addition, do weight training and not just aerobic exercises. Be sure that if you buy these health supplements, you buy the original and take extra care to be sure it is not fake, as many products in the market contain steroids and androgens.
